PrepAway - Latest Free Exam Questions & Answers

Which code segment should you insert at line 04?

You create a Microsoft ASP.NET application by using the Microsoft .NET Framework version 3.5.
You create the following controls:
A composite custom control named MyControl.
A templated custom control named OrderFormData.
You write the following code segment to override the method named CreateChildControls() in the MyControl class. (Line numbers are included for reference only.)

01 Protected Overrides Sub CreateChildControls()
02 Controls.Clear()
03 Dim oFData As New OrderFormData("OrderForm")
04
05 End Sub

You need to add the OrderFormData control to the MyControl control.
Which code segment should you insert at line 04?

PrepAway - Latest Free Exam Questions & Answers

A.
Template.InstantiateIn(Me)
Me.Controls.Add(oFData)

B.
Template.InstantiateIn(oFData)
Controls.Add(oFData)

C.
this.TemplateControl = (TemplateControl)Template; // -Can’t Remember All-???
oFData.TemplateControl = (TemplateControl)Template;
Controls.Add(oFData);

D.
Me.TemplateControl = DirectCast(oFData, TemplateControl)
‘ -Can’t Remember All-???
Controls.Add(oFData)


Leave a Reply